Job description

Summary Of Position Mission

This position will provide support to the Supply Chain Manager in procuring production, packaging, services and supplies. Initiates purchase orders and amendments for parts, services, and/or special tools; arranges for submission and inspection of sample products as required; and coordinates closely with plant engineering and quality to assure timely execution of product and services sourcing activities.

Responsibilities
  • Monitor and track supplier quality and delivery metrics.
  • Utilize competitive bidding processes to select and manage suppliers with respect to cost, quality, and delivery competitiveness for assigned responsibilities.
  • Demonstrate excellent supplier negotiation skills.
  • Secure and analyze quotations; negotiate prices and terms with suppliers; and recommend suppliers with respect to cost, quality, and delivery competitiveness.
  • Organize and maintain online supplier folders to record all agreements, compliance documents, orders, and records for the supply chain.
  • Ensure the contractual documents accurately reflect terms and conditions of purchase, including payment terms, freight terms, incoterms, and other key commercial terms.
  • Visit suppliers’ facilities to qualify them as new sources and assist in resolving production, design, quality, and/or delivery problems.
  • Ensure maintenance and accuracy of all BOM lead times and standard costs in the ERP system, implementing changes and tracking variances as required.
  • Effectively use verbal and written communication to provide resolution and status updates to team members, internal customers, and suppliers.
  • Work with internal customers to identify and address unmet needs that align with procurement and business goals to deliver long‑term value.
  • Analyze root causes of accounts payable exceptions and take steps to resolve and prevent them.
  • Assist in implementing new sourcing/inventory strategies.
  • Maintain strong computer skills, including experience in Microsoft Office and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P/MRP) systems.
  • Be highly organized to manage multiple product lines.
  • Manage purchasing and inventory activities; purchase supplies and materials at the optimal price and delivery cycle while maintaining lowest possible inventory levels.
  • Engage in problem solving, including root cause analysis, and implement corrective action.
  • Monitor and communicate key industry developments and trends (shortages, price escalations, etc.).
  • Manage and administer building/property keys and security camera access.
  • Protect the organization’s value by keeping information confidential.
  • Support and adhere to all ISO standards applicable to the company.
  • Wear all necessary personal protective equipment directed by the company at all times.
  • Demonstrate complete working knowledge of firearms safety.
  • Maintain and keep the workstation and department area clean.
  • Immediately report any maintenance and/or safety issues to management.
  • Demonstrate a positive attitude toward co-workers, other departments, and the company.
  • Maintain respect, courtesy, and professionalism toward all co-workers and the company.
  • Communicate clearly and effectively with co‑workers and management.
  • Actively participate in and support the 5S process within the work area on a daily basis.
  • Other duties will be assigned as required.
